Sefton: sefton at cutjibnewsletter.com | The Morning Report — 1/29/25![]() A Massachusetts resident has been taken into custody at the U.S. Capitol after allegedly intending to assassinate Treasury Secretary Scott Bessent, according to court documents. Ryan Michael “Reily” English approached Capitol Police on Monday afternoon, voluntarily surrendering himself and stating his possession of weapons, including Molotov cocktails and a knife.English reportedly had planned to target Defense Secretary Pete Hegseth and House Speaker Mike Johnson. However, his focus shifted to Bessent after learning about the Senate’s vote on Bessent’s nomination as Treasury Secretary. English’s arrest occurred approximately three hours before Bessent’s appointment was confirmed. . . In the affidavit filed in federal court, English claimed he considered attacking Bessent by throwing Molotov cocktails or stabbing him if an opportunity arose. The affidavit outlined the discovery of two Molotov cocktails, constructed from vodka bottles and cloth wicks soaked in hand sanitizer, and additional weapons during a search conducted by officers. . . The two individuals suspected in the shooting death of a U.S. Border Patrol officer near the Canadian border in Vermont last week are believed to be tied to a transgender militant group. Teresa “Milo” Youngblut and Felix “Ophelia” Baukholt were stopped by the Border Patrol officer along Interstate 91 in Coventry, Vermont, with the officer and Baukholt—a German national—subsequently dying from wounds received in a shootout. The revelation is raising concerns about a possible trans terror cell operating domestically in the U.S.Surveillance on the pair began when staff at a motel in Lyndonville, Vermont., reported their suspicious behavior, noting tactical clothing and weapons. Law enforcement asserts that Baukholt was armed during the confrontation and was fatally shot after attempting to use his weapon. . . . . . Felix Baukholt, a German national, was living in the U.S. on an H-1B visa. Baukholt, described by acquaintances as a youth math prodigy, worked as a quantitative trader in New York after graduating from the University of Waterloo in Canada. Meanwhile, Youngblut—identifying with neo-pronouns—has been charged with using a deadly weapon and discharging a firearm during the assault that killed agent David Maland, an Air Force veteran.
